This subcontract opportunity is for the supply and installation of reinforcing steel and cast-in-place concrete for prime contractors working on San Bernardino County Department of Public Works projects. The selected provider will be responsible for installing concrete reinforcing and pouring structures in accordance with SSPWC standards, utilizing approved curing compounds to deliver completed concrete structures and pads. The project is managed by the California Public Works Solid Waste agency and is located in San Bernardino, zip code 92415-0017. Interested parties must submit their responses by the deadline of September 17, 2026, at 5:00 PM. The contract falls under NAICS code 238110.

The Unit 2 Phase 5-2 Liner Construction Project at the San Timoteo Sanitary Landfill in Redlands, California, is a public works solicitation issued by the San Bernardino County Department of Public Works, Solid Waste Management Division. The project involves the construction of a composite liner, buttress excavation, subdrain, backfill, and operations layer access roads, with a total performance period of 350 working days from the Notice to Proceed. Key milestones include the completion of the buttress excavation and composite liner within 155 working days and access road improvements within 65 working days following a traffic switch. Bidders must hold a State Contractor A License and provide detailed project history, personnel qualifications, and references to be considered. The solicitation requires strict adherence to California Labor Code prevailing wage determinations and CARB compliance for diesel-fueled fleets. Bidders must submit comprehensive bid packages, including signed bid forms, bid bonds, and subcontractor lists, via the ePro electronic procurement system or in person by the deadline of September 22, 2026. The project mandates rigorous quality control and construction quality assurance, with specific technical requirements for geosynthetic clay liner packaging and equipment labeling. A mandatory job walk and pre-bid meeting are required at the landfill site, where attendees must wear proper personal protective equipment, including safety vests, hard hats, and working boots.
